Shamimunisa Mustafa, Ph.D.
Assistant professor of pediatrics

Phone: 210-567-5278
Fax: 210-567-5169
Email: mustafa@uthscsa.edu

Education:
Ph.D., biological chemistry, University College London, 1992
B.S., medicinal chemistry, University College London, 1988

Training:
Fellowship, biochemistry, UT Health Science Center, San Antonio, 1992-98

Recent Publications:
Reeves, AA, Mustafa SB, Henson, BM, Vasquez MM, Castro R. Trafficking and Function of the Epithelial Sodium Channel Is Inhibited By Epidermal Growth Factor In A Rat Parotid Gland Cell Line 2007 Jan. (Journal of Investigative Medicine).
McAdams RM, Mustafa SB, Shenberger JS, Dixon PS, Henson BM, Digeronimo RJ. Cyclic stretch attenuates the effects of hyperoxia on cell proliferation and viability in human alveolar epithelial cells. Am J Physiol Lung Cell Mol Physiol 2006 Feb;291:L166-L174.
Mustafa SB, DiGeronimo RJ, Petershack JA, Alcorn JL, Seidner SR. Postnatal glucocorticoids induce alpha-ENaC formation and regulate glucocorticoid receptors in the preterm rabbit lung. Am J Physiol Lung Cell Mol Physiol 2004 Jan;286(1):73-80.
